Eichert, Werner

Date of birth:
December 18th, 1913 (Nekla, Schroda district, Posen, Germany)
Date of death:
August 1st, 1943 (Ssneshnoje, Mius, Ukraine)
Buried on:
German War Cemetery Kharkiv
Grave: UNK.
Service number:
SS Nr.: 37.430 // NSDAP-Nr.: 1.268.860
Nationality:
German (1933-1945, Third Reich)

Biography

01.09.1934-14.04.1935: LSSAH
01.11.1934-31.03.1935: Führeranwärterlehrgang LSSAH
15.04.1935-15.02.1937: V. SS-Totenkopf-Verband 'Brandenburg' - Oranienburg
16.02.1937-00.10.1939: Stab I./ SS-Totenkopf-Standarte 'Thüringen'
00.10.1939-30.11.1939: 9./ SS-Totenkopf-Infanterie-Regiment 3, SS-Totenkopf-Division
01.12.1939-03.05.1940: II./ SS-Totenkopf-Regiment 12 - Litzmannstadt
20.04.1940: promoted to SS-Obersturmführer
05.05.1940: SS-Totenkopf-Ersatz-Bataillon III
25.08.1941: SS-Totenkopf-Division
00.01.1942: 1. Kompanie, SS-Totenkopf-Kradschützen-Bataillon, SS-Totenkopf-Division - Staraja Russa
12.01.1942: Lipowizy, 5km East of Staraja Russa
15.01.1942: WIA at the shoulder
17.07.1942: fightings in Bol. Dubowizy and Rykalovo
01.03.1943: Stepanovka
21.06.1943: promoted to SS-Hauptsturmführer
01.08.1943: KIA in the Mius region as Kdr, 3./ SS-Panzer-Aufklärungs-Abteilung 3
